Scrolling down will net you further information, including the local user accounts and their last login date, printers and their port, GPU/display adaptors, webcams, virus protection and definition version, and network adaptors. Check GPU specs, users, and internet adaptors.The readout will include information like your OS build and localization processor model, memory caches, and cores available space on each drive and RAM information and even the Windows 10 product key and other serial numbers of installed third party software. It’s up to you if you want to skip the step or wait for it to complete, but it shouldn’t take long at all.īelarc Advisor will open its report in your default browser after saving a. Tick “Remember this choice and don’t ask me again”, then press “Yes”.īelarc will scan the local network for relevant information. On first start, it’ll ask if you’d like to check for these definitions. One major benefit to Belarc is that it will automatically check your PC to see if you have any missing security definitions that could affect the safety of your device. After running it, you can follow the instructions below to see your full PC info. One popular solution in that regard is Belarc Advisor, which is free for personal home use. While Microsoft’s in-built tools do a serviceable job, third-party applications can give more detailed readouts in an easily shareable readout.
